Job Title: Lead Dimensional Engineer – Autonomous Vehicle Sensors
Location: Foster City, CA
Pay Range: $90-$100/hour + Benefits
What's the Job?
- Lead the dimensional management for multiple major vehicle programs, ensuring precise sensor integration across different architectures.
- Define and validate functional requirements for vehicle build and sensor placement to establish reliable baseline standards.
- Establish robust datum schemes, sensor mounting strategies, and tolerance allocations to maintain calibration stability.
- Review and approve metrology fixtures, ensuring alignment with strict program assembly and measurement standards.
- Collaborate with suppliers and cross-functional teams to evaluate capabilities, define acceptable limits, and manage engineering escalations.
What's Needed?
- 8 to 10 years of experience in dimensional management, variation simulation, or metrology within automotive, aerospace, or autonomous robotics sectors.
-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Fixture Design Engineering, or a related technical field.
- Strong understanding of statistical process control (SPC), variation analysis tools, and basic statistical concepts such as CP, CPK, and gauge R&R studies.
- Proficiency in GD&T principles, with experience creating, validating, and optimizing complex technical drawings.
- Practical expertise using CATIA V6 and 3DEXPERIENCE (3DX) for 3D model interrogation and dimensional evaluation.
